Gene
ssl10
Protein
Staphylococcal superantigen-like 10
Organism
Staphylococcus aureus (strain NCTC 8325)
Length
227 amino acids
Function
Plays a role in the inhibition of host complement activation via the classical pathway by interacting with the Fc region of human IgG and thereby interfering with the IgG/C1q interaction (PubMed:19913916). Inhibits also the penultimate step of plasma clotting by interacting with prothrombin/F2 and coagulation factor X/F12. Does not affect the protease activity of thrombin but interferes with the conversion of prothrombin to thrombin (PubMed:23754290, PubMed:28193526). Interacts with human receptor CXCR4 and specifically inhibits CXCL12-induced calcium mobilization and cell migration (PubMed:19308288).
Similarity
Belongs to the staphylococcal/streptococcal toxin family.
